Benthic infaunal baseline survey data (february) of the sediments around the exploration Well 14/09-A Little Blue

Collected in 0.1m2 grab sample. Sieved in field through 500m sieve. Washed samples fixed in 10% formalin and stained with Rose Bengal. Two samples with greatest volume at each station (nominally the A and B samples) were sent for further sorting and analysis. Third sample retained, but not sorted. Samples washed again in laboratory through 500?m sieve then hand sorted. Organisms identified to a range of taxonmic resolutions including Family, genus, species and morphospecies. Taxa grouped by phyla and then species within each phyla. Where identidication unsure or unknown, species designation is to a higher taxonomic level. Where genus know, but unique unidentified species designated with an alphabetical code after Genus (i.e. A, B, C etc.). Where positive identification was not possible because of damage, or because they were juveniles, these are designated by 'damaged' or 'juv.' respectively after the lowest identifiable taxonomic level. Accuracy Differential GPS accuracy to within 5 m, Identification of some invertebrate taxa questionable due to poor taxonomic understanding of offshore benthic species around Falkland Islands probably accurate to genus for most, or family where indicated.
